Church
St. Nicholas Cathedral is a 13th-century Gothic church in , . Established in c. 1247, the church became Lutheran in 1573. It was damaged by fire in the late 18th century and suffered damage during World War II. is situated 1 km west of Park Wojska Polskiego.
